Potash in Canada: Context, Importance, and Global Food Security

Potash is not merely a mineral—it’s an essential nutrient for plant growth and crop yield stability. In Canadian agriculture, potash plays an irreplaceable role in supporting optimal soil fertility, water regulation, disease resistance, and stress tolerance in crops.

Why Potash Is Essential for Agriculture and Food Security

  • 🌾 Potassium (K)—the central active element in potash—regulates water use in plant tissues, enhances drought tolerance, and supports cellular functions crucial for high yields.
  • 🌱 Improves disease and pest resistance, reduces plant stress, and supports grain, tuber, and fruit formation in crops.
  • 📈 Enables balanced fertilizer plans, pairing efficiently with nitrogen and phosphorus to optimize nutrient uptake (commonly termed NPK blends in modern agronomy).
  • 🌍 Canadian potash company supply chains are critical for global food security, especially in regions facing nutrient-deficient or drought-prone soils.
  • 💧 Maintaining soil health, supporting agriculture, and buffering volatile fertilizer prices in the global market.

In practical terms, Canadian potash companies supply granular, standard, and specialty potash forms, used in everything from cereals and canola to vegetables, pulses, and forestry nurseries. Their efficient supply chains help mitigate price volatility and ensure reliable nutrient programs for farmers—an increasingly crucial service as climate change and soil depletion affect global agriculture.

Industry Structure: Major Canadian Potash Companies

The Canadian potash industry is concentrated geographically—and structurally—in Saskatchewan. Here, vast, high-grade ore deposits support a world-leading resource and mining complex. The sector is characterized by the following:

Dominant Players within Canada’s Potash Sector

  • 🏢 Large, multinational potash producers—with well-established mining infrastructure, logistics networks, and port/export terminals (e.g., Nutrien Ltd, Mosaic Company, K+S Potash Canada).
  • 🇨🇦 Canadian subsidiaries of global firms that benefit from local geology, regulatory familiarity, and strategic partnerships with local producers.
  • 🔧 Service and equipment providers, including blasting, drilling, environmental monitoring, reclamation, and mine safety specialists, support complex and capital-intensive operations.

The competitive advantage for Canadian potash companies comes from their proximity to extensive ore reserves, established value chains, and a combination of regulatory, geological, and operational experience unmatched in global markets.

Potash Value Chain & Operating Model in Canada

The value chain for potash companies Canada involves a carefully integrated series of steps—from initial exploration through to on-farm application:

  1. Exploration and Mine Development: Centered mainly in Saskatchewan, uses both underground and solution mining methods to access high-grade potash ore.
  2. Ore Extraction, Crushing, and Milling: Transforming raw ore into market-ready potash using specialized processing facilities and advanced refining techniques.
  3. Packaging, Product Customization, and Distribution: Granular, standard, and specialty potash products are manufactured to meet the specific needs of agricultural markets.
  4. Logistics and Export: Canadian infrastructure includes robust rail and deep-water port connections, supporting international export to North America, Asia, and beyond.
  5. Farm-Level Application: Agronomists and crop advisors assist farmers in optimizing potash use to increase yield and quality—a crucial last step in the value chain.

Sustainability, Regulation & Land Stewardship in Potash Operations

Canadian potash companies recognize that sustainability and environmental stewardship are fundamental—not optional—in modern industry landscapes. Here’s how the sector is navigating this complex challenge:

Key Environmental Practices and Regulatory Drivers

  • 🔬 Reclamation planning: Mines implement progressive site reclamation to restore land for agriculture, forestry, or wildlife habitat post-mining.
  • 💧 Water conservation: Innovative water recovery, recycling within ore processing, and groundwater monitoring to reduce freshwater withdrawals.
  • 🌬 Air and dust suppression: Facilities use advanced emissions control to reduce particulate matter and limit GHG output.
  • 🌱 Support for soil health and nutrient-use efficiency: Investment in R&D targeting lower-input, higher-output farming systems.
  • 📑 Strict compliance: Adherence to provincial (Saskatchewan Ministry of Environment) and federal (Canadian Environmental Assessment Act) permitting and monitoring frameworks.

Economic & Community Impacts of Potash Mining

Canadian potash companies are foundational to the economic vitality of Saskatchewan and Canada at large. Their extensive activity impacts communities, suppliers, and the international trade landscape.

  • 🏛 Regional employment: Thousands employed directly in mining, processing, logistics, and indirectly through local supplier networks and services.
  • 💵 Municipal and provincial revenues: Potash operations support local schools, health clinics, roads, and infrastructure development via royalties and tax flows.
  • 🌎 Export stability: Potash helps stabilize Canada’s trade balance, as international demand for food and fertilizer increases.
  • 📉 Challenges: The sector faces price volatility, high capital requirements, and carbon intensity reduction goals moving into 2026 and beyond.

FAQs: Canadian Potash Companies and Industry Trends 2026

What is potash, and why is Canada a leading supplier?

Potash refers to potassium-rich mineral salts, essential for plant growth and crop yields. Canada, particularly Saskatchewan, possesses among the world’s largest high-grade potash ore deposits and operates the most advanced mining and processing infrastructure, making it the leading global supplier.

How do Canadian potash companies support environmental stewardship?

By prioritizing water conservation, progressive reclamation, emissions reduction, and responsible fertilizer production, Canadian potash companies are recognized for industry-leading sustainability programs. Many aim to lower their operational carbon footprints by up to 20% by 2026.

How do potash supply chains help Canadian farmers?

Efficient, reliable supply ensures Canadian farmers access high-specification potash on time, mitigating price spikes and supporting consistent, balanced fertilizer programs to boost yields and soil health.

What is the outlook for the potash industry in 2026?

Global fertilizer demand remains strong, with modernization of Canadian potash company operations supporting both sustainability and competitive exports. Innovation in digital mining, ESG monitoring, and satellite-driven exploration will drive future growth.
